Q: Suppose a student is selected at random from 80 student where 30 are taking mathematics,20 are taking chemistry, and 10 are taking mathematics and chemistry. Find the probability that the student is taking mathematics or chemistry
Tutorial:
P(Math or Chem) = P(Math) + P(Chem) - P(Math and Chem)
= (30/80) + (20/80) - (10/80)
